Garlic Cauliflower Mushroom Skillet Recipe

A quick and delicious Garlic Cauliflower Mushroom Skillet that combines tender cauliflower florets and sautéed mushrooms with aromatic garlic and seasoning for a flavorful, healthy side dish or light main course.

Ingredients

Scale

Vegetables

  • 1 medium head cauliflower, cut into florets
  • 8 ounces mushrooms, sliced
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ced

Cooking Essentials

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Salt, to taste
  • Black pepper, to taste
  • Optional: fresh parsley or thyme for garnish

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Vegetables: Rinse the cauliflower and mushrooms thoroughly. Cut the cauliflower into bite-sized florets and slice the mushrooms evenly. Mince the garlic cloves finely for even flavor distribution.
  2. Heat the Skillet: Place a large skillet over medium heat and add the olive oil. Allow the oil to warm up but not smoke, ensuring it’s ready for sautéing.
  3. Sauté Garlic: Add the minced garlic to the hot oil and cook for about 30 seconds until fragrant, careful not to burn it to keep the garlic flavor mild and pleasant.
  4. Cook Vegetables: Add the cauliflower florets and sliced mushrooms to the skillet. Season with salt and black pepper. Stir occasionally and cook for 8-10 minutes or until the cauliflower is tender and the mushrooms have released their juices and browned slightly.
  5. Finish and Serve: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Optionally, garnish with fresh parsley or thyme before serving. Serve warm as a healthy side dish or a light vegetarian main.

Notes

  • Use fresh garlic for the best flavor impact.
  • Red pepper flakes can be added for a spicy kick.
  • For a richer taste, add a splash of lemon juice or a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ese after cooking.
  • This dish pairs well with grilled meats or can be enjoyed on its own for a low-carb meal.
  • To keep it vegan, omit cheese or use a vegan alternative if desired.
